Rory Daniel McIlroy, a professional golfer from Northern Ireland was born on May 4, 1989. Rory McIlroy competes on both the European and PGA Tours. As a professional and amateur, Rory has represented Ireland, Great Britain, and Europe. He represented Europe in the Ryder Cup matches against the United States in 2010, 2012, 2014, 2016, 2018, and 2021.

In 2010, 2012, 2014, and 2018, Europe prevailed. He has received the RTÉ Sports Person of the Year award twice, in 2011 and 2014, for his individual and team accomplishments.

Rory McIlroy has won 37 times in his professional career, including 24 times on the PGA Tour, 16 times on the European Tour, one each on the Asian Tour and PGA Tour of Australasia, and four times in other events. Rory has been atop the Official World Golf Ranking for 122 weeks; on March 4, 2012, he reached his highest position of 1.

Which major championships has Rory McIlroy won?

Rory McIlroy won four major championships, including the PGA Championship in 2012 and 2014, the U.S. Open in 2011, and The Open Championship in 2014.

On June 19, 2011, at the U.S. Open at Congressional in Bethesda, Maryland, Rory won his first major championship. Throughout the entire week, Rory's level of play was unmatched, and his dominance of the game is demonstrated by his 8-stroke advantage over Jason Day, who took second place. In addition to breaking several records, Rory's victory included a new U.S. Open record with a 72-hole total score of 268 (16-under).

On South Carolina's Kiawah Island (Ocean Course), on August 12, 2012, Rory triumphed in the 2012 PGA Championship. With a birdie on the last hole, Rory won by eight strokes, breaking the previous record of the PGA Championship.

With a three-stroke advantage going into the final round, Rory dominated the competition by shooting a perfect 66 with no bogeys. Since Seve Ballesteros' 1980 Masters victory, Rory became the youngest major winner at the time, with this victory at age 22.

Rory defeated Rickie Fowler and Sergio Garcia by two strokes to win the 2014 Open Championship on July 20 at Royal Liverpool. He had been in the lead after every round of the tournament, and the victory was his third major championship overall. The only golfers to win both the Silver and the Gold Medals at The Open Championship are Rory McIlroy and Tiger Woods.

Rory defeated Phil Mickelson by one shot to win the 2014 PGA Championship at Valhalla in Louisville, Kentucky, one week after winning his first-ever WGC event at the WGC-Bridgestone Invitational. This victory was Rory McIlroy's fourth major victory.
